If you use Crunchyroll for watching anime and want to use it to enjoy the latest manga, the Crunchyroll Manga app is an excellent choice. This app lets you read the hottest manga titles as soon as they are published in Japan. Some of the most popular titles available on this app are Attack on Titan, Space Brothers, Coppelion, and Fairy Tail.

The Manga Plus app is the official globally available manga reader app issued by the Japanese publisher Shueisha. This app is a must-have for those who want to read manga online. It features classics like Naruto, One Piece, Dragon Ball, and Bleach, along with other manga from different genres.

One of the best things about this app is its user interface. You can see previews of every title, check out the trending list, access new manga, etc. Thanks to the user-friendly design, even those new to the manga and manhwa world will have no trouble navigating it.

Manga Rock allows you to download and read a wide range of manga series in numerous languages. You can download multiple volumes at once and minimize the downloader so that you can keep using your device for other tasks.

ComicRack is an app available on Windows and Android that allows you to read comics and manga. Although it primarily focuses on comics, it also has an extensive library of manga titles that you can either download, buy or read online. One of the things that make ComicRack stand out is its user-customizable interface, which allows you to personalize it according to your preferences.

Another great feature of ComicRack is its ability to organize your comic collection. You can create custom lists, tags, and ratings to keep track of your favorite titles. Additionally, ComicRack has a built-in search function that allows you to easily find specific comics or manga within your collection.

Komikku is a GTK4/libadwaita manga reader built in Python and GTK4/libadwaita. It supports both online and offline reading of content from a gargantuan list of servers available in all kinds of languages.

The ESP12F minimal setup is linked to a power management IC for power and an LCD screen, which is controlled by the ESP8266 board. The code contains sections of each slide/manga panel that are run in a sequential loop.

The Result of this built is a pocket manga reader that continuously loops through panels of manga; yes, the image quality is not the best and it required a tedious process of converting each image into C Code and then combining that code to make a single long code that is flashed into ESP8266 board.
